What is non invasive brain stimulation

Non invasive brain stimulation methods have gained attention for their potential to influence neural activity without surgery. Among these, a common technique involves applying a mild electrical current to specific regions of the scalp. The aim is to modulate neuronal excitability and, with repeated sessions, support practical goals such as mood Tdcs Brain Stimulation regulation, focus, or sleep quality. For individuals curious about this approach, understanding how the method interacts with brain networks helps set realistic expectations about benefits and limitations. It is important to consult reputable sources and healthcare professionals before trying any at home protocols.

Considerations and safety notes

Any self administered intervention carries potential risks, including skin irritation, headaches, or discomfort if the device is not used properly. It is prudent to check compatibility with existing medical devices, skin sensitivities, and contraindications such as implanted hardware or conditions affecting skull integrity. If adverse effects appear, cease use and seek professional medical advice promptly. This approach emphasises caution, evidence based practice, and a commitment to well informed decisions.
